Parties in Greece are making their last pitch for votes ahead of a repeat election seen as crucial to the debt-laden country's future in the eurozone.

The economic crisis has hit many Greeks hard, with job losses, pay cuts and home repossessions all too common.

The BBC's Tim Willcox spoke to a couple living in Athens who, faced with a huge drop income, have had to turn to their parents for financial help.
